确保用户信息安全Redis存储用户数据(用户信息保存在redis)
随着电子商务的不断发展,用户信息安全成为商家的普遍关注热点。传统的MySQL存储系统当处理大型数据时容易滞后,因此Redis也成为一种用来储存客户数据的很受欢迎的机制。
Redis能够在分布式环境中迅速读取和写入数据,从而使服务器处理请求更快,而且还可以改善网站性能。Redis还可以对客户信息进行精细化管理,从而极大地提高用户体验和用户信息安全。例如,当用户登录网站或使用定制化服务时,Redis可以根据用户访问频率进行动态加载,只储存有限的数据,从而最大限度地减少系统数据负载,有效保护用户的真实数据不被破坏和泄漏。
另外,Redis还支持数据加密,利用敏感数据的加密与解密技术,可以在保存和传输数据的过程中对其进行加密,从而更有效地保护用户数据。例如,下面的代码展示了如何使用Redis创建加密数据并保存在hash表中:
// 使用给定的Key,将加密数据保存在hash表中
hset key "encrypted_user_data" encrypted_data
// 设置键的有效期,以确保数据有效性EXPIRE key 60
Redis支持实时备份,可以使用实时备份的技术来预防丢失数据的风险,从而最大程度地保证数据安全。
Redis存储系统实现了快速、安全可靠的用户数据储存,可以有效改善用户体验并确保用户信息安全。